UK juice specialist Plenish is launching a non-dairy beverage made from cashews.

Plenish Organic Cashew M*lk, available in a 1-litre carton, will complement Plenish’s existing Almond Nut M*lk, which it launched at the end of last year. 

Made from organic cashews, filtered water and Himalayan salt, Organic Cashew M*lk is already available from Ocado and will also be sold in Waitrose from July, with a recommended retail price of GBP3.49 (US$5.05). A spokesperson told just-food as yet there were no plans to enter other mainstream channels.

According to Plenish, non-dairy milk alternatives are “big business” in the UK, now being purchased by one in every four households. The nut and seed milk category is currently the best performing sector in the dairy alternatives market, growing by 73.8% to GBP51.8m in the year to May 2015, according to Kantar Worldpanel figures.

Organic Cashew M*lk has 6% cashew content and contains no additives, preservatives or sweeteners. Plenish says the new product is a natural source of plant-based protein, which helps maintain healthy muscles and bones.
